MESINA Business

1 second ago Electrical and Electronics Mumbai 511 views
Location
Products Details

1, SINRISE, 4TH PASTA LANE, COLABA,,http://www.mesina.in,400005,CRANE AIR CONDITIONING UNITS. Air-conditioning & Equipment


 
UA-172447835-1